United Way of Summit and Medina

Akron, Ohio  ·  EIN 341169257  ·  Private foundation

United Way of Summit and Medina is a Ohio-based grantmaker. In its latest 990-PF filing it reported $16.0M in annual giving against $22.6M in assets. What United Way of Summit and Medina funds

United Way of Summit and Medina's giving carries a documented focus on civil rights & social justice, early childhood education, education, disaster relief & emergency aid, financial empowerment, and related causes.

How to apply for funding from United Way of Summit and Medina

United Way of Summit and Medina's public IRS filing does not spell out a formal application process. Foundations of this size often give primarily to organizations they already know, so a concise letter of inquiry or a warm introduction is usually the best first contact — not a full proposal.
